Autor Zpráva
caradoc
Profil *
Dobrý den, prosím o pomoc,
potřebuji zařídit abych psal text do formuláře v řádku
<input type='text' name='pole' value=''>

a javascript tato data ihned "kopíroval" i do druhého řádku "input" ale v jiném formuláři na té samé stránce,
děkuji za příklady,

Caradoc
SwimX
Profil
caradoc:
např
<form name='form1'>
  <input name='pole'>
</form>

<form name='form2'>
  <input name='pole2'>
</form>
    <form name='form1'>
    <input name='pole'>
   </form>

<script>
  var a = document.forms["form1"].elements["pole"];    
  with(a) onchange = onclick = ondblclick = onmousedown = onmouseup = onkeypress = onkeydown = onkeyup = function (){
  document.forms["form2"].elements["pole2"].value = a.value;  
  };    
</script>
  

Pozor na používání with!
caradoc
Profil *
moc díky, pomohlo,..

Vaše odpověď

Mohlo by se hodit

Neumíte-li správně určit příčinu chyby, vkládejte odkazy na živé ukázky.
Užíváte-li nějakou cizí knihovnu, ukažte odpovídajícím, kde jste ji vzali.

Užitečné odkazy:

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m: